Understanding Andersen Windows
Andersen Windows has established a reputation for offering high-quality, energy-efficient windows. Their products come in various styles, including:
- Double-hung windows
- Casement windows
- Sliding windows
- Picture windows
Each style is designed to meet different aesthetic preferences and functional needs, making Andersen a go-to brand for many homeowners.

What to Consider When Choosing Andersen Windows
When selecting Andersen Windows from Lowe’s, consider the following factors:
- Window Style: Choose a style that complements your home’s architecture.
- Energy Efficiency: Look for Energy Star rated windows to save on energy costs.
- Material: Andersen offers wood, composite, and vinyl options, each with its advantages.
- Installation: Decide whether you’ll install the windows yourself or hire a professional.

Troubleshooting Common Installation Issues
Even experienced DIYers can encounter issues during window installation. Here are some troubleshooting tips:
- Improper Fit: If the window doesn’t fit properly, remeasure the opening and check for level.
- Drafts: Ensure all seals are tight and apply caulk where necessary to prevent air leaks.
- Difficulty Opening or Closing: Check for obstructions and ensure the window is installed level.
Maintaining Your Andersen Windows
Once your Andersen Windows are installed, maintaining them is essential for longevity. Here are some maintenance tips:
- Regular Cleaning: Clean the glass and frames regularly to prevent buildup.
- Check Seals: Inspect weatherstripping and seals annually to ensure they are intact.
- Lubricate Moving Parts: For operable windows, lubricate hinges and tracks to ensure smooth operation.
